"You will see spells of good football and pure football, but then you're going to see spells of turnovers, second balls and things like that just because of the nature of the schedule," said Cooper.

"We've only just started this busy period now up until the international break.

"So I think you've got to do a bit of everything, and tonight we did that."

Swansea play seven times in the space of 22 days before the March international break, with four of those matches being away from home
